Gearing Up - Motorcycle Safety Course
Saturday, 06 January 2007

The Canada Safety Council is well known across Canada for its work in the development and delivery of a range of personal and professional safety programs, initiatives and safety campaigns. One of the highest profile, and most successful, programs developed and managed nationally by the Canada Safety Council is the Gearing Up motorcycle rider training program.

Since 1974 over 325,000 Canadians have learned how to ride motorcycles from the professionals who teach the Canada Safety Council's Gearing Up motorcycle training program.

Gearing Up is Canada's only national motorcycle rider training program. It has developed an enviable reputation both in Canada and internationally for its excellence in course curriculum (below) and delivery. That excellence has led to several provinces allowing riders to obtain their motorcycle license without taking any skill test other than the one delivered

Initial 2007 Ride for Sight Event Details
Tuesday, 21 November 2006

The team has finalized the date for the 2007 Ride for Sight event here in Saskatchewan. It’s August 18th & 19th, 2007 starting at Thunder City the morning of the 18th and leaving for Moose Jaw.

We’ll be at the Western Development Museum on Saturday for some bike games, show & shine, food, drinks and more. If you came last year, expect the same great time - but we're also working on a number of things to add to the event this year to be announced as they are confirmed.

The camping location is still to be determined but we’re looking at a few campgrounds within 30-45 minutes of Moose Jaw. Of course, everyone is welcome to come (riders or not) and they can either come just for the events at the WDM or join in on the camping as well.The minimum donation for the cause (in order to take part in the event) is $50.00 but those donations can be raised by picking up a donor book at Thunder City in Regina.
